Output 886e935256583515bbbf8ec4717884a2d055b2ffe9043a119efcf579eb923938:0

value
35380851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7db63a519166487be579939de5f5cdcce33112e7 OP_EQUAL
address
MKMrzpTNE12pbf9Ro7SVctNvUURVqkHZQL
transaction
886e935256583515bbbf8ec4717884a2d055b2ffe9043a119efcf579eb923938
spent
true